Atmospheric oxidation mechanism of chlorobenzene
Chemosphere, 2014The atmospheric oxidation mechanism of chlorobenzene (CB) initiated by the OH radicals is investigated at M06-2X/6-311++G(2df, 2p) and ROCBS-QB3 levels. The oxidation is initiated by OH addition to the ortho (∼50%), para (∼33%) and meta (∼17%) positions, forming CB-OH adducts as R2, R3, and R4; while the ipso-addition is negligible (∼0.2%).

Tricarbonyl(η6-chlorobenzene)chromium
Acta Crystallographica Section C Crystal Structure Communications, 2003The title compound, [Cr(C(6)H(5)Cl)(CO)(3)], is the first group 6 tricarbonyl eta(6)-monohaloarene compound to be structurally characterized. It adopts a classic piano-stool structure, with the Cr(CO)(3) tripod assuming a syn-eclipsed conformation relative to the arene ring (varphi = 2.0 degrees ).
